Ethereum's Checkpoint #9 Just Dropped — Here's What the Core Devs Are Focused On in April 2026

124d ago · 1 source

The Ethereum Foundation published its ninth development checkpoint update, summarizing the current state of Ethereum protocol development as of April 2026. The update covers ongoing progress across Ethereum's roadmap, including upgrades, research priorities, and ecosystem milestones.

WHY IT MATTERS

Think of Ethereum like a massive software platform — similar to how your phone's operating system gets regular updates to fix bugs and add features. These 'checkpoint' posts are like the development team's progress report, telling everyone what they've been working on and what's coming next. For anyone who holds ETH, uses Ethereum-based apps, or is building on the network, these updates matter because they shape how fast, cheap, and secure the network will be in the future. Even if the technical details seem complex, the key takeaway is that Ethereum is actively being improved — and the direction of those improvements can affect everything from transaction costs to the value of ETH itself.
